The Complete Montigo Fireplace Lineup

Montigo manufactures eleven fireplace series spanning direct-vent gas, gas inserts, wood burning, outdoor, and commercial applications. The Torch Guys is an authorized dealer for every one of them. Here is how the complete lineup compares, based on Montigo's official product brochures:

Series Best For Sizes & Configurations Key Features Price Range
Direct Vent Fireplaces
DelRay Linear Clean, modern linear design at the best entry point in Montigo's lineup 36", 48", 60", and 72" single-sided linear models (DRL3613, DRL4813, DRL6013, DRL7213), each available in Basic or Full Load (-2) trim Slim 14¾" framing depth on 36/48/60 (16" on the 72"); 16,000–35,000 BTU; 63–71% efficiency; Traditional, Cool Wall Release, and Cool Wall Advantage finishing options allow combustible materials right to the glass opening; Full Load trim adds multi-function remote, Hi-Lo flame control, fans, halogen downlighting, micro-mesh safety screen, black reflective glass, and battery backup $3,200 – $8,900+
DelRay Square Square viewing area with the flexibility to run traditional log sets or contemporary media on the same burner 34" (DRSQ34NI), 38" (DRSQ38NI), 42" (DRSQ42NI), and 46" (DRSQ46NI) single-sided, each available in Basic or Full Load (-2) trim 15,500–40,000 BTU; Montigo's patented Universal Burner lets you swap between traditional logsets (Split Oak, Birch, Driftwood) and contemporary media without changing the burner; seven liner options including Tan Brick, Vintage Brown Brick, Red Brick, Grey Ledgestone, Ash Fluted, Grey Herringbone, and Black Reflective Glass Contact for pricing
Distinction Luxury single-sided or see-through with the broadest feature set standard and rebate-eligible efficiency 36" (D3615), 48" (D4815), 63¾" (D6315), and 72" (D7215), each available single-sided or as a see-through (ST) 35,000–57,000 BTU; the D4815 hits a rebate-eligible 77.49% efficiency; LED accent lighting, Proflame 2 multi-function remote, fan kit, and 30% flame turndown (50% on the D3615) all standard; Cool Wall Advantage required, with heat drawn via 5" flex vents to a TV plenum or sidewall kit so a TV can sit above the fireplace $5,700 – $13,000+
Divine Multi-Sided Room dividers, bays, and corner installs where linear units can't fit See-through (H38FSD, H42FSD), corner left/right (H38CL/CR, HL38CL/CR), pier/room divider (H38PF, HL38PF), and bay/180° (H38PR, HL38PR) 34,000–37,000 BTU NG; 57.2–68.3% efficiency; choice of traditional burner (Heritage brick liner, wrought iron grate, logset) or contemporary burner (Ice Fireglass); Satin Black or Stainless Steel surrounds; the only Montigo residential series offering true corner, pier, and bay configurations Contact for pricing
Exemplar Dramatic, oversized contemporary statement pieces and hard-to-vent locations that need the flexibility of a power-vented design Single-sided R320/R420/R520/R720/R820 (viewing 37¾"–97¾"), large-format RP620, see-through R320ST/R420ST/R520ST/R620ST, indoor-outdoor R324STIO, and the RP424 premium pier 45,000–100,000 BTU; frameless window glass design; power vented to install virtually anywhere (wall, flush wall, roof, or inline mount); 24VAC home-automation compatible; the RP424 features Montigo's patented COOL-Pack cool-to-touch glass (no safety screen required); the R324STIO has a built-in power vent for indoor-outdoor installs with no external venting Contact for pricing
Paragon Traditional aesthetic with modern engineering — the most realistic traditional flame in the Montigo lineup 36" (DVCT36CBP95N), 40" (DVCT40CBP95N), and 50" (DVCT50CBP95N) single-sided; 40" see-through (DVCT40CSP95N) 40,000–60,500 BTU; TruFlame Technology delivers the most realistic traditional flame presentation Montigo makes; liner options include Grey Herringbone, Black Porcelain, Tan Brick, and Vintage Brown Brick; 15-year warranty Contact for pricing
Phenom Mid-range direct-vent option in single-sided or see-through configurations, with Basic and Full Load tiers Single-sided P38DF/PL38DF, P42DF/PL42DF, P52DF/PL52DF; see-through L38FSD, L42FSD, L52FSD 25,000–40,000 BTU; 57–59% efficiency; Full Load trim adds concealed burner with Quartz Firebeads, multi-function remote, remote-controlled fans, black porcelain liner, halogen uplighting, remote Hi-Lo flame, micro-mesh screen, and battery backup Contact for pricing
Gas Inserts
Illume Inserts Retrofitting an existing masonry fireplace opening with the highest-efficiency gas insert in the Montigo lineup 30FID (24¾" × 14¾" viewing, 24,000 BTU) and 34FID (28¾" × 18¾" viewing, 31,000 BTU), each available in Traditional or Contemporary style 77.4–81.1% efficiency — the highest in the Montigo lineup and rebate-eligible in many markets; co-linear venting fits existing masonry chimneys (30FID 3"/3", 34FID 4"/3"); masonry cavity minimums of 30"W × 20"H × 14"D (30FID) or 34"W × 24"H × 15"D (34FID) Contact for pricing
Wood Burning Fireplaces
Wildfire Fireboxes Authentic wood-burning fireplaces for homeowners who want real fire and crackle, with the flexibility to retrofit a gas logset later WB36FB0F (36" × 30" viewing), WB44FB0F (44" × 30"), and WB54FB0F (54" × 34") True zero-clearance wood firebox; can also accept a gas logset; 12" flue chimney system; 12 brick liner combinations (Gray/White/Mocha/Black × Traditional/Smooth/Herringbone); optional bi-fold glass doors (Black or Pewter), outside air kit, hearth extension, and log grate; 15-year warranty Contact for pricing
Outdoor Fireplaces
Outdoor Series Covered patios and outdoor living spaces needing a ventless, weather-ready fireplace H Series single-sided (H34VO, H38VO, HL38VO, H42VO), see-through (H38SVO, HL38SVO), and the freestanding Mahana patio line (PL42VO, PL60VO). The Exemplar R324STIO is also available for built-in indoor-outdoor wall installs. 26,000–47,000 BTU; all ventless; 304 stainless steel construction; Mahana models offer zone heating up to 10 feet with optional LED backlighting, pedestal, and cover; enclosure colors in Stainless, Carbon RAL 9005, Graphite RAL 7015, and Dune RAL 9002; 15-year warranty Contact for pricing
Commercial Fireplaces
Prodigy Commercial properties, luxury homes, hospitality, restaurants, hotels, and ultra-custom projects with 150+ configurations 36" to 96" wide (PC3, PC4, PC5, PC6, PC7, PC8) × glass heights from 12" to 60"; single-sided, see-through, corner, bay, or indoor-outdoor (with IO seal kit); NG-only QuickShip program in PC420, PC520, PC620, and PC820 40,000–112,000 BTU; patented COOL-Pack glass stays as low as 115°F — touch-safe, no safety screen required; built with US-milled steel; commercial-grade valve, burner, and control; multicolor LED lighting; intake dampers; CSA certified; 24VAC home-automation compatible; 10-year warranty Contact for pricing

How to Choose the Right Montigo Fireplace

With eleven residential and commercial series, choosing the right Montigo comes down to a few key decisions. Here is a quick framework:

1. Measure Your Space and Decide on Shape

Montigo builds fireplaces in widths from 34 inches up to 97¾ inches (and all the way to 96 inches wide in the commercial Prodigy). For a standard living-room wall, a 48" or 60" linear model usually hits the right proportion. If your space calls for a square viewing area instead of a linear ribbon, look at the DelRay Square. If you need the fireplace to serve as a room divider, sit in a bay, or wrap a corner, the Divine Multi-Sided is the only residential series with all four body styles.

2. Choose Your Venting Configuration

Most Montigo residential fireplaces are direct vent — they draw combustion air from outside and exhaust through a sealed vent system, which makes them safe for any room and efficient to operate. If your install is complex or you need an indoor-outdoor fireplace, the Exemplar is power vented and can be installed virtually anywhere with wall, flush wall, roof, or inline mount options. The Illume Inserts are co-linear and retrofit into existing masonry fireplace openings. The Wildfire line is Montigo's only wood-burning series and uses a traditional 12" chimney.

3. Decide on Features vs. Budget

The DelRay Linear is Montigo's most accessible series and ships in a Basic trim or a Full Load (-2) trim with remote, fans, Hi-Lo flame, halogen downlighting, micro-mesh screen, black reflective glass, and battery backup. The Distinction steps up to higher BTU output, 30% flame turndown (50% on the D3615), LED accent lighting, Proflame 2 remote, and fan kit as standard. Distinction's D4815 also hits a 77.49% efficiency rating, which qualifies for rebates in many markets. For the most dramatic flame presentations and touch-safe glass, the Exemplar RP424 and the commercial Prodigy use Montigo's patented COOL-Pack technology.

How much does a Montigo fireplace cost?
Montigo residential fireplaces typically range from $3,200 to $13,000 or more, depending on the series, size, and configuration. The DelRay Linear starts around $3,200 for the 36-inch Basic model and runs to about $8,900+ for the 72-inch Full Load. The Distinction runs from about $5,700 up to $13,000+ for the 72-inch see-through. Exemplar, Paragon, Divine, and the commercial Prodigy are priced by configuration — contact The Torch Guys for a quote on specific models.

Is Montigo a good fireplace brand?
Yes. Montigo has been manufacturing gas fireplaces in Langley, British Columbia since 1976 and is widely regarded as a premium brand. They pioneered the first sandpan gas logset and direct-venting technology and today have the largest selection of linear fireplaces in the industry. They are known for patented innovations like COOL-Pack cool-to-touch glass, TruFlame Technology, and Cool Wall Advantage, and they back all residential units with a 15-year warranty on the burner and firebox.
What is the difference between Montigo DelRay and Distinction?
The DelRay Linear is Montigo's most accessible residential series, featuring a slim 14¾" framing depth (16" on the 72"), 16,000 to 35,000 BTU, 63 to 71 percent efficiency, and pricing from about $3,200 for the 36-inch Basic model. The Distinction is the premium single-sided or see-through series with 35,000 to 57,000 BTU, LED accent lighting, Proflame 2 multi-function remote, 30 percent flame turndown (50 percent on the D3615), and a fan kit all standard. Distinction's D4815 also hits a rebate-eligible 77.49 percent efficiency. Cool Wall Advantage is required on Distinction, which allows a TV to sit safely above the fireplace.

Can I install a Montigo fireplace myself?
Montigo fireplaces require professional installation. They are direct-vent, power-vented, co-linear, or wood-burning appliances that involve gas line connections and venting through an exterior wall, roof, or chimney. A licensed contractor or certified hearth installer should handle the installation to ensure safety and compliance with local building codes. How does Montigo compare to Napoleon fireplaces?
Both are premium Canadian fireplace manufacturers, but they serve different needs. Montigo specializes exclusively in gas and wood fireplaces with a focus on customization, premium features like COOL-Pack cool-to-touch glass and TruFlame Technology, and both residential and commercial applications. Napoleon offers a broader product range including gas, electric, wood, and outdoor fireplaces, with more options for inserts and freestanding units. Montigo tends to offer more customization at the high end and has the largest selection of linear fireplaces in the industry, while Napoleon provides wider installation flexibility and a broader entry-level price range.
